In Oracle PL/SQL I was used to write:
SELECT * FROM MY_TABLE WHERE ROWNUM <= 100;
in order to fetch only the first 100 records of the table named MY_TABLE.
What could be the equivalent SELECT statement in SQL SERVER?
In SQL-Server You can Use TOP to select the no. of rows.
SELECT TOP 100 * FROM MY_TABLE
